If I had to change something about the picture, it would be two things:

  1. There is a green/cyan cast in the ULC and URC in the clouds. Maybe you could push the cyan hue a little bit in the blue direction (but only localy).
  2. There is a yellow spot in the sky at the right edge of the image. My eye is always drawn to it. I would try to push the yellow hue slightly to orange and desaturate it a bit. Then it will fit better in the rest of the sky.
  3. I would remove the dust spots.
